Court of Justice of the European Union · Judgment

C‑512/10European Commission v Republic of Poland

Decided
2013-05-30
ECLI
ECLI:EU:C:2013:338
CELEX
62010CJ0512
Finality
Final, the decision cannot be appealed

The court's own keywords

Failure of a Member State to fulfil obligations — Transport — Directive 91/440/EEC — Development of the Community’s railways — Directive 2001/14/EC — Allocation of railway infrastructure capacity — Article 6(2) and (3) of Directive 2001/14 — Continued absence of financial balance — Articles 6(1) and 7(3) and (4) of Directive 91/440 — Absence of incentives for infrastructure managers — Articles 7(3) and 8(1) of Directive 2001/14 — Calculation of the minimum access charge.
